nonce 区块链

2025-04-21 12:17:44
人气 2001

Nonce(Number only used once)是一种区块链技术中常见的概念。它在保证数据的安全性和完整性方面起着重要作用。本文将对nonce的定义、作用以及与区块链之间的关系进行详细探讨。

首先,我们来了解一下nonce的定义。Nonce指的是一个只使用一次的数字或字符串。在区块链中,nonce用于增加区块的难度,使得矿工需要进行大量的尝试才能找到正确的结果。每个区块都有一个特定的nonce值,矿工需要通过不断调整nonce值来满足系统设定的某些条件,从而成功地添加新的区块到区块链中。

那么nonce在区块链中的作用是什么呢?首先,nonce可以防止篡改数据。由于每个区块的nonce值是唯一且只使用一次的,一旦有人试图篡改数据,就会导致nonce值的不匹配,进而被其他节点识别出来。这种机制保证了区块链的数据安全性,有效防止了黑客攻击和数据篡改行为。

此外,nonce还可以控制区块产生的速度。通过调整nonce值,可以改变矿工添加新区块的难度。当网络负荷过大时,可以增加nonce的难度,以降低矿工添加新区块的速度,从而保持整个区块链网络的稳定运行。相反,当网络负荷较小时,可以降低nonce的难度,提高矿工添加新区块的速度,促进区块链的扩展和发展。

同时,nonce还具有与工作量证明机制(Proof of Work,PoW)相关的重要性。在以比特币为代表的一些区块链系统中,矿工需要找到一个符合一定条件的nonce值,这个过程需要大量的计算力和能源消耗。通过完成一定量的工作量,矿工可以获得相应的区块奖励。因此,nonce不仅是实现区块链去中心化和安全性的关键,也是激励矿工参与到区块链系统中的方式之一。

总结起来,nonce作为一种只使用一次的数字或字符串,在区块链技术中起着至关重要的作用。它不仅能够保证数据的安全性和完整性,还能够控制区块产生的速度,并与工作量证明机制密切相关。通过了解和理解nonce的概念和作用,我们可以更好地理解区块链技术的工作原理,并在未来的应用中发挥其巨大的潜力。


声明:文章不代表塔岸网观点及立场,不构成本平台任何投资建议。投资决策需建立在独立思考之上,本文内容仅供参考,风险自担!转载请注明出处!侵权必究!
币圈快讯
2025-04-30 16:39:04
特朗普私人律师Jim Trusty转向加密货币游说行业成立NexusOne
2025-04-30 13:19:00
印度高等法院下令封锁加密邮件服务Proton Mail
2025-04-30 13:03:31
币安VIP借币新增HYPER、INIT、KERNEL、SIGN、WCT可借资产
2025-04-30 12:47:22
WLFI今晨大额增发USD1后疑似披露拟暂时停止增发
2025-04-30 12:07:16
Binance Earn推出Solv Protocol BTC链上持仓返利功能
2025-04-30 11:51:19
美国参议员David McCormick披露已将100万美元自有资金投入比特币
查看更多
回顶部